When is it Time to Consider Window and Door Replacement?

Understanding when to replace your doors and windows can save you money in the long run and avoid potential headaches. Neglecting the indications of aging or damage can lead to increased energy costs, security vulnerabilities, and even structural concerns. Here are some key indications that recommend it might be time for a replacement:

  • Drafts and Cold Spots: Feeling drafts near doors and windows, specifically throughout cooler months, is a clear sign of air leak. Old or improperly sealed units allow conditioned air to get away and outdoors air to penetrate, making your home less comfortable and increasing heating & cooling expenses.
  • Condensation and Fogging: Condensation on the interior glass surface area is typical in humid conditions. However, persistent fogging between the glass panes suggests a damaged seal in insulated glass units. This implies the insulating gas has actually gotten away, rendering the window less energy-efficient and potentially causing damage.
  • Difficulty Opening and Closing: Windows and doors that are tough to open, close, or lock are not only inconvenient but likewise present security dangers. Warping, swelling, or damage to frames and mechanisms can cause these concerns, indicating the need for replacement.
  • Noticeable Damage: Look for obvious signs of damage such as cracked or decomposing frames, chipped or damaged glass, and decay. These concerns jeopardize the structural stability and performance of your windows and doors.
  • Increased Energy Bills: If your energy bills are regularly rising, in spite of no substantial changes in usage routines, inefficient windows and doors could be a significant offender. Older, single-pane windows and doors are particularly bad insulators compared to modern, energy-efficient options.
  • Outdated Style and Curb Appeal: Windows and doors play a significant function in the general aesthetic of your home. If your doors and windows look out-of-date or diminish your home's design, replacement can dramatically improve curb appeal and improve your home's appearance.
  • Sound pollution: If outside sound is ending up being progressively intrusive, consider updating to windows developed for sound reduction. Modern windows with several panes and specialized glazing can considerably reduce sound pollution, producing a more serene indoor environment.

Exploring Your Options: Types of Windows and Doors

The world of windows and doors offers a huge variety of materials, designs, and performances. Comprehending your alternatives is important to choosing that finest suit your home's specific requirements and visual choices.

Window Materials:

  • Vinyl: A popular option due to its price, energy performance, low upkeep, and durability. Vinyl windows come in various colors and designs and offer excellent insulation.
  • Wood: Known for their natural charm and warmth, wood windows provide exceptional insulation and can be personalized for particular architectural designs. However, they require more upkeep, consisting of painting or staining, and can be more expensive.
  • Aluminum: Lightweight, strong, and low-maintenance, aluminum windows are frequently selected for modern homes. They are long lasting and resistant to rust, but they are less energy-efficient than vinyl or wood.
  • Fiberglass: Combining the strength of aluminum with the insulation of wood, fiberglass windows are highly long lasting, energy-efficient, and low-maintenance. They are resistant to warping, rot, and insects, making them a long-lasting alternative.
  • Composite: Made from a blend of products like wood fibers and plastics, composite windows provide the look of wood with boosted sturdiness and lower upkeep. They are energy-efficient and resistant to rot and bugs.

Window Styles:

  • Double-Hung Windows: Classic and versatile, double-hung windows have two sashes that slide vertically, enabling ventilation from the top or bottom.
  • Casement Windows: Hinged at the side and crank open outward, casement windows offer outstanding ventilation and a tight seal when closed, boosting energy effectiveness.
  • Awning Windows: Hinged at the leading and open outside, awning windows are perfect for ventilation even throughout light rain, as they supply a protective overhang.
  • Moving Windows: Slide horizontally along tracks, using easy operation and a modern appearance. They are a great option for spaces where you desire to maximize views.
  • Picture Windows: Large, set windows that do closed, image windows are designed to make the most of natural light and views.
  • Bay and Bow Windows: These forecasting window combinations add architectural interest and create a sense of spaciousness. Bay windows usually have 3 areas, while bow windows have four or more.

Door Materials:

  • Wood: Traditional and elegant, wood doors use charm and warmth, particularly for entry doors. They can be personalized and stained or painted but require regular maintenance.
  • Fiberglass: A popular choice for entry doors, fiberglass doors are resilient, energy-efficient, and low-maintenance. They can mimic the look of wood while using exceptional weather condition resistance.
  • Steel: Known for their security and sturdiness, steel doors are a strong and cost-efficient alternative, particularly for entry and outside doors. They can be insulated for energy effectiveness and painted for aesthetic appeal.
  • Composite: Similar to composite windows, composite doors & windows near me combine numerous materials for improved sturdiness, energy efficiency, and low maintenance.
  • Glass: Often used for patio area doors, glass doors take full advantage of natural light and views. Choices include sliding glass doors, French doors, and bi-fold doors, each offering special visual and practical advantages.

Kinds of Doors:

  • Entry Doors: The centerpiece of your home's outside, entry doors been available in different products and styles to enhance curb appeal and security.
  • Patio area Doors: Designed to supply access to outdoor patios, decks, or yards, outdoor patio doors include moving glass doors, French doors (hinged), and bi-fold doors (folding panels).
  • Storm Doors: Installed outside of entry doors, storm doors provide an additional layer of defense versus weather elements, enhance insulation, and can boost security and ventilation.

The Windows and Doors Replacement Process: A Step-by-Step Overview

Replacing windows and doors is a task that needs cautious planning and execution. Whether you select to hire experts or tackle it as a DIY project, understanding the process will ensure a smoother and more successful result.

  1. Consultation and Assessment: The primary step generally includes an assessment with a window and door expert or a specialist. They will examine your existing windows and doors, discuss your requirements and choices, and offer suggestions based upon your home's design, budget plan, and energy performance objectives.
  2. Picking Products and Customization: Based on the assessment, you will pick the materials, styles, and features for your new windows and doors. This is the time to check out personalization options such as grid patterns, hardware surfaces, glass types (e.g., low-E, tinted, soundproof), and color choices.
  3. Precise Measurement and Ordering: Accurate measurements are critical for correct fit and performance. Experts will take accurate measurements of your doors and window openings to ensure the brand-new units are purchased to the right size.
  4. Removal of Old Windows and Doors: Carefully getting rid of the old windows and doors is necessary to prevent damage to the surrounding walls and frames. This process usually involves separating the units, removing nails or screws, and carefully extracting them from the openings.
  5. Installation of New Windows and Doors: The brand-new windows and doors are thoroughly positioned into the openings, ensuring they are level and plumb. They are then secured with shims, fasteners, and insulation to develop a tight and weather-resistant seal.
  6. Completing and Sealing: Once installed, the gaps between the window/door frames and the wall are filled with insulation and sealed with caulk or cut to prevent air and water leakages. Outside trim may be included for an ended up appearance.
  7. Clean-up and Inspection: The final step includes cleaning up any particles and building and construction materials. An extensive inspection is carried out to ensure correct setup, operation, and sealing of the new doors and windows.

Navigating Cost Considerations and Budgeting

The cost of doors and window replacement can differ significantly depending upon a number of factors. Comprehending these elements will help you budget effectively and make notified choices.

Factors Influencing Cost:

  • Materials: The option of product, whether vinyl, wood, fiberglass, or aluminum, directly impacts the price. Premium materials typically feature a greater expense.
  • Size and Number of Units: Larger windows and doors and a higher number of units will naturally increase the overall job expense.
  • Design and Complexity: Custom styles, elaborate styles, and specialized features (e.g., custom-made grids, decorative glass) can add to the price. Bay and bow windows are usually more pricey than standard windows.
  • Installation Costs: Labor costs for professional installation differ depending upon the intricacy of the project and the location.
  • Geographic Location: Material and labor expenses can differ based on your geographical area and local market conditions.

Budgeting Tips:

  • Get Multiple Quotes: Obtain quotes from a minimum of 3 various specialists to compare rates and services.
  • Think About Financing Options: Many business provide financing options to assist expand the expense of doors and window replacement.
  • Element in Long-Term Energy Savings: While the preliminary investment might seem significant, bear in mind that energy-efficient windows and doors will result in long-lasting cost savings on your energy expenses.
  • Focus on Areas: If budget is a concern, consider changing windows and doors in the most troublesome areas initially, such as those with drafts or noticeable damage.
  • Look for Rebates and Incentives: Check for federal government or utility company rebates and rewards for energy-efficient window and door upgrades, which can assist offset expenses.

Picking the Right Contractor for a Successful Project

Picking a trusted and knowledgeable professional is vital for a successful window and door replacement project. A qualified specialist ensures proper setup, prompt conclusion, and peace of mind.

Secret Considerations When Choosing a Contractor:

  • Reputation and Reviews: Check online evaluations and ask for referrals from previous customers. A specialist with a strong credibility is most likely to deliver quality workmanship.
  • Licensing and Insurance: Verify that the contractor is appropriately licensed and insured. This protects you from liability in case of mishaps or damages during the job.
  • Experience and Expertise: Inquire about the specialist's experience in window and door replacement, especially with the types of materials and designs you are considering.
  • Service warranties and Guarantees: Ensure the specialist offers warranties on their craftsmanship and that the windows and doors included maker warranties.
  • Interaction and Customer Service: Choose a professional who interacts plainly, is responsive to your questions, and provides outstanding customer service throughout the process.

The Benefits of Professional Installation

While DIY window and door replacement may seem appealing to conserve cash, expert setup uses considerable benefits:

  • Proper Fit and Sealing: Professional installers have the knowledge and tools to guarantee windows and doors are set up properly, with precise measurements and tight seals, making the most of energy effectiveness and preventing leaks.
  • Warranty Protection: Many window and door producers require expert installation for their service warranties to be legitimate. DIY installation might void warranties, leaving you accountable for any problems.
  • Effective Installation: Experienced installers can finish the task effectively and effectively, minimizing disruption to your home and daily routine.
  • Comfort: Hiring professionals provides assurance knowing that the job is done properly, and any possible concerns will be handled by knowledgeable personnel.
  • Increased Home Value: Properly set up, premium windows and doors enhance your home's worth and interest potential purchasers.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: How long does doors and window replacement generally take?A: The period depends on the variety of windows and doors being replaced, the complexity of the installation, and weather. For a basic home, it can vary from one to a number of days.

Q: What is the very best season for window and door replacement?A: While doors and windows can be replaced year-round, many property owners choose milder seasons like spring or fall for more comfy working conditions. However, professional installers can work successfully in a lot of climate condition.

Q: Can I replace doors and windows myself?A: While DIY window and door replacement is possible, it is usually suggested to work with professionals, particularly for complex tasks or if you lack experience. Expert installation makes sure proper fit, sealing, and warranty protection.

Q: How much value does doors and window replacement contribute to my home?A: New windows and doors can significantly increase your home's worth and curb appeal. Energy-efficient upgrades are particularly attractive to buyers. The precise increase varies depending on market conditions and the quality of the replacement.

Q: How do I tidy brand-new windows and doors?A: Most brand-new windows and doors & windows near me are easy to tidy with mild soap and water. Prevent abrasive cleaners that might harm the surfaces. Refer to the producer's standards for specific cleaning recommendations.
